When the Chinese tech company DeepSeek unveiled its latest large language model (LLM), R1, it sent a seismic shock across the global tech landscape. This wasn’t just because R1 rivals top models like OpenAI’s GPT-4, but because it was developed at a fraction of the cost and released for free. The unveiling rattled the tech market and caught the attention of policymakers and industry leaders worldwide.
The DeepSeek Method: A New Way Forward
DeepSeek’s approach flips the traditional AI development script. Typically, building powerful LLMs involves dual stages: pretraining on vast datasets followed by post-training refinements requiring substantial human input. Historically, organizations like OpenAI have relied heavily on human-driven processes like supervised fine-tuning and Reinforcement Learning with Human Feedback (RLHF). DeepSeek diverges by automating post-training with a novel reinforcement learning technique known as Group Relative Policy Optimization (GRPO), significantly reducing the need for costly human intervention.
This shift has yielded impressive results, especially for tasks involving math and code, where this automated feedback is most effective. While there are limitations in handling more subjective or creative tasks, DeepSeek compensates with China’s cost-effective resources, making the entire process cheaper.
Innovations and Implications
DeepSeek’s R1 has also set a precedent in using existing resources innovatively. The company used datasets like Common Crawl to efficiently filter relevant information and leveraged hardware in unconventional ways, optimizing legacy GPUs beyond standard software limits. This resourcefulness underlies their claim of training V3, the backbone of R1, for under $6 million.
The incorporation of multi-token prediction, where the model predicts sequences of words rather than isolated tokens, not only accelerates training but enhances accuracy. This feature hints at a future where machines can anticipate and engage more naturally in human dialogues.
A Changing Landscape in AI
DeepSeek’s revelations are likely to be a catalyst for broader industry transformation. American AI giants and tech companies worldwide are now keenly chasing similar efficiency and transparency in their AI innovations. Companies like Microsoft, AI2, and Hugging Face are either replicating or building upon DeepSeek’s model, aiming to lower the barrier to cutting-edge AI development.
DeepSeek’s trailblazing methods highlight an emerging trend: the democratization of powerful AI technologies. As these technologies become less expensive to develop and more widely available, the AI landscape will see increased collaboration, possibly leveling the playing field between startups and established titans. This evolution promises a new era of AI capabilities, driven by efficiency and openness, redefining what’s possible in tech innovation.
